Analytics can be used to determine the effectiveness and efficiency of a video

Video analytics are an essential part to any video marketing strategy. Your metrics can help you to define your goals and provide a clearer picture of your video's progress across the internet. You should first monitor the number of views. Views are vital because they indicate how many people saw your video. But, that doesn't necessarily imply that they watched it. You need to look at more details in order to measure video success.
You can determine whether your video is effective by counting the number of interactions it has generated. The conversion rate measures the number or potential customers that a video has generated. The other metrics to monitor are website views, engagement, clicks on specific links, and brand impressions. You can track specific content performance on your website with custom analytics, feedback forms and polls, in addition to the quantitative metrics. You can also determine which channels are most successful in driving traffic to your site with video views.

What makes content marketing different to traditional advertising?
Traditional advertising focuses on getting attention, while content marketing focuses on providing value. Traditional advertising is often a waste because most people ignore them. However, content marketing can lead to much higher engagement rates.

How can I measure success with content marketing?
There are several ways to measure the effectiveness of your content marketing strategy.
Google Analytics is one of the best measurement tools. This tool lets you see where your targeted traffic comes from and what pages they visit most frequently.
It also tells you how long each visitor stays on your site before leaving.
You can use this information to improve the content you create to grab people's attention, and keep them interested for longer periods of time.
These questions can also help you determine the success of your content marketing efforts.
Is my email newsletter providing any value to my subscribers? How much of my entire mailing lists have become paid members? How many people clicked through to my landing pages? Are people who click through more likely to convert than others?
These are all important metrics you need to monitor and track over time.
Another way to measure your content marketing success? Look at how often people share links to your content on social networks.
